We work to Schedule Medical Health assessment for the Members of the insurance companies (Insurance holders)
You would need to convince these members to take up the appointment with our Nurse practitioners and PCPs
This will involve extensive calling around 12-15 calls per hour
There is no charge for the members to be paid, it has no cost attached to it
Your shift timings can be changes as per the business needs within the window of 12hrs from 6am PST to 6pm PST
You would be following the given scripts for calling
Training period will be of 1 week and 2 weeks will be of On Job training which will include a part of calling as well.
